§ 6-147 — Multiple designations of a candidate for a party position

New York·Law ELN Election·Art. 6 Designation and Nomination of Candidates
§ 6-147. Multiple designations of a candidate for a party position. 1.\nThe name of a person designated on more than one petition as a candidate\nfor a party position to be filled by two or more persons shall be\nprinted on the ballot with the group of candidates designated by the\npetition first filed unless such person, in a certificate duly\nacknowledged by him or her and filed with the board of elections not\nlater than the tenth Tuesday preceding the primary election or five days\nafter the board of elections mails such person notice of his or her\ndesignation in more than one group, whichever is later, specifies\nanother group in which his or her name shall be printed.\n 2.
